Spectre is a 2015 spy film and the twenty-fourth in the James Bond series produced by Eon Productions for Metro-Goldwyn-Mayer and Columbia Pictures. It is the fourth film to feature Daniel Craig as the fictional MI6 agent James Bond and the second film in the series directed by Sam Mendes following Skyfall.

What does Spectre mean in 007?
SPECTRE (Special Executive for Counter-intelligence, Terrorism, Revenge and Extortion) is a fictional organisation featured in the James Bond novels by Ian Fleming, the films based on those novels, and video games.

Who is SPECTRE daughter?
Madeleine Swann
Madeleine Swann is a fictional French psychiatrist originally affiliated to the Austrian Hoffler Klinik organization. She is also the daughter of the mysterious SPECTRE member Mr. White and the lover of Secret Intelligence Service (SIS/MI6) operative James Bond.
Is Franz Oberhauser the brother of James Bond?
In this continuity, he was born Franz Oberhauser, the son of Hannes Oberhauser (a character from the original short story “Octopussy”, portrayed here in two photographs by Thomas Kretschmann), James Bond’s (Daniel Craig) legal guardian after being orphaned at the age of 11, making him and Bond adoptive brothers.

Is Quantum a Spectre?
Quantum is a fictional criminal organisation featured as the antagonists in the James Bond films Casino Royale and its sequel Quantum of Solace. It is ultimately revealed in the 2015 James Bond film, Spectre, that Quantum is merely a division of the much larger organisation, SPECTRE.

Is Skyfall a reboot?
First of all they’re actually a reboot. Whereas all the previous movies didn’t really care that much about their respective prequels, Casino Royale was the first to actively reboot the whole franchise and introduce James Bond as a completely new character recently promoted to 00-status.
Why is Spectre so bad?
To be fair to Spectre, the movie inherited somewhat of a mess in terms of storyline. The 24th Bond movie was faced with the task of tying together the previous three Craig-led films while simultaneously dealing with behind-the-scenes rights issues.
Who is the leader of Spectre in Spectre?
The film makes it so SPECTRE and its leader Ernst Stavro Blofeld (Christoph Waltz) were behind the nefarious plots in Casino Royale, Quantum of Solace, and Skyfall. This was summed up in a line from Waltz’s Blofeld where he claims to be “the author of all [Bond’s] pain.”

How much money did Spectre make worldwide?
Spectre grossed over $880 million worldwide, making it the sixth-highest-grossing film of 2015 and the second-largest unadjusted total for the series after Skyfall. The next Bond film, No Time to Die, is set for release in 2021, with Craig reprising his role and Cary Joji Fukunaga directing it.
